WOWSS Crossing Golfo Dulce

The World Open Water Swimming Series (WOWSS) offers a global network of races that attract swimmers of all ages, abilities and backgrounds, Olympians, marathon swimmers, disabled athletes and people who just started the sport.

FEA – Student´s Art Festival

The Student’s Art Festival includes three stages: institutional, Circuital, and regional, in addition to the national participation. In these encounters, the participants present their artistic skills such as dance, choreography, drawing, theater, and music.
